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 35% of 42.2 using proportion.

35% is 35 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 35 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 42.2.

\[ \frac{ 35 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 42.2 } \]

Cross-multiply: 35 × 42.2 = 100x

\[ 35 \cdot 42.2 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(35 × 42.2)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 1477 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 35% of 42.2 is 14.77.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 35% to decimal: 0.35

\[ x = 42.2 \cdot 0.35 \]

Multiply 42.2 × 0.35 = 14.77

So, 35% of 42.2 is 14.77.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 35% to decimal: 0.35

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

42.2 × 0.35 = 14.77

Thus, 35% of 42.2 is 14.77.
